One unmistakable trend in 2026 is how precisely platforms profile user behavior. The old "one number for everything" approach now reads as a high-risk pattern. The practical fix: split your verification scenarios into three categories.
| Account Type | Recommended Approach |
|---|---|
| Core store accounts | Use stable number segments tied to primary devices; avoid frequent rebinding. |
| Review and buyer accounts | Batch verification works, but keep registration profiles clearly distinct to dodge similarity flags. |
| Community and social accounts (WhatsApp, Telegram, etc.) | Prioritize long-term number stability for private traffic and audience building. |
Too many cross-border teams run all three categories through the same pipeline. Then one test account trips a risk alert, and the core store gets swept into a linkage review. SMS verification is simply infrastructure. The real edge comes from assigning each number a defined role and enforcing strict usage boundaries.
The second major shift: account health scoring now covers far more than registration IP and device fingerprints. Platforms are weighing operation time windows, login frequency, and even payment behavior in their assessments.
That opens the door to a high-leverage pattern: using verification numbers to enforce risk tiers. When a new platform rule lands and you're not sure how it'll behave, run the experiment on a trial verification number first. Once the workflow proves itself, migrate your core business over. The same principle applies to appeals—a flagged account can complete phone verification in minutes with a clean number, which dramatically shortens the recovery window.
The model that keeps producing results is splitting numbers into two pools: trial and mainline. The trial pool absorbs testing and failure costs. The mainline pool only touches proven, mature workflows. This works especially well for small teams because it doesn't inflate overhead while meaningfully reducing overall exposure.
One detail worth flagging: keep platform behavior cleanly isolated per number. If a number registers on Amazon, don't reuse it to sign up for other e-commerce platforms. Cross-platform traces are easy to spot and nearly impossible to explain away once flagged.
Solo sellers and boutique studios don't have a 30-person ops team to lean on. The winning move is squeezing more marginal value out of every verification number you touch.
I've watched successful independent sellers run their numbers like a small asset ledger. Every number has a clear purpose, a labeled record after registration, and a recurring calendar reminder to log in. There's a reason for this discipline: in 2026, platforms are aggressively reclaiming inactive numbers. The register-and-forget approach used to fly. Now a dormant number gets wiped out within months.
The classic newcomer mistake: registering a whole batch of numbers, coming back three months later, and realizing they're all gone. Your verification provider won't send a courtesy reminder. That burden falls squarely on your operational habits.
